Establishing a Limited Liability Partnership (LLP) for Your Venture

A Limited Liability Partnership (LLP) can be a beneficial choice for entrepreneurs who wish to limit their personal liability while building a collaborative business. When creating an LLP, it's crucial to adhere the legal regulations in your jurisdiction.

This typically involves filing articles of partnership with the appropriate government agency and choosing a registered agent. It's also important to create a comprehensive partnership agreement that clearly outlines each partner's roles, responsibilities, profit-sharing arrangements, and dispute resolution procedures. By thoroughly establishing your LLP, you can secure legal protection for yourself and your business while fostering a successful entrepreneurial journey.

Grasping Corporate Structures: Sole Proprietorship, Partnership, LLC

When venturing on a business path, it's crucial to select the right corporate structure. Three common options are the sole proprietorship, partnership, and LLC. A sole proprietorship is the most basic form, where the business is owned and operated by one person. In a partnership, two or more individuals pool their resources to manage a business together. An LLC, or Limited Liability Company, offers protection from personal liability for its owners.
